A Comprehensive Skills Analysis of Novice Software Developers Working in the Professional Software Development Industry
نویسندگان
چکیده
Measuring and evaluating a learner’s learning ability is always the focus of every person whose aim to develop strategies plans for their learners improve process. For example, classroom assessments, self-assessment using computer systems such as Intelligent Tutoring Systems (ITS), other approaches are available. Assessment metacognition one these techniques. Having evaluate monitor one’s known metacognition. An individual can then propose adjustments process based on this assessment. By monitoring, improving, planning activities, who manage cognitive skills better able knowledge about particular subject. It common that students’ metacognitive abilities have been extensively studied, but no research has carried out mistakes novice developers make because they do not use enough. This study aims assess software working in industry describe consequences awareness performance. In proposed study, we experimented with collected data Devskiller log analyze self-regulation skills. The showed when asked reflect upon work, become more informed habitual mistakes, helps them highlight repetitive experiences which allows performance future tasks.
منابع مشابه
Improving Professional Software Skills in Industry A Training Experiment
With over a decade of Software Process Improvement in large organisations, the awareness of its importance has propagated to Small to Medium Enterprises (SMEs). The most well known models for SPI are primarily suited for largeor medium-sized organisations, but with some tailoring they can provide substantial support for SPI in small organisations. The IPSSI (Improving Professional Software Skil...
متن کاملProfessional end user developers and software development knowledge
This paper seeks to explore how IT professionals might best support professional end user development. By ‘professional end users’, we mean practitioners of some recognized technical, scientific or mathematical profession, who develop software in order to further their professional goals. Our field studies demonstrate that such software development takes place within a culture in which it is pe...
متن کاملIs usability evaluation important: the perspective of novice software developers
Usability evaluation is an important and strategic activity in software projects (IEEE Computer Society, 2004). Its relevance had been recognized in the context of the user (Lindgaard & Chattratichart, 2007) and the software organization (Bak et al., 2008). However, several studies had identified important obstacles to its applicacion in software developement process (Bak et al., 2008; Ardito e...
متن کاملReluctant Software Developers - Tactical Software Management Issues for Developing Software Outside the Software Industry
The issue of strategic software development management generally assumes the organization is in the software industry. However, there are cases of non-software vendors who have successfully built from within and even disseminated the results within their industry. These organizations must also grapple with strategic and tactical software management issues. Case studies and comparisons of such o...
متن کاملDelphi Study of the Cognitive Skills of Experienced Software Developers
In the present paper, a qualitative research of the cognitive skills of experienced software developers is presented. The data for the research was gathered using the Delphi method. The respondents were 11 software developers who have worked at least five years after their graduation. Two questionnaire rounds were conducted. In the first round, the respondents mentioned altogether 32 different ...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: Complexity
سال: 2022
ISSN: ['1099-0526', '1076-2787']
DOI: https://doi.org/10.1155/2022/2631727